Development of a Test Method to Measure the Quality of Milling Operations in Asphalt Pavements (05-0903)**
Victor Lee Gallivan, Gallivan Consulting, Inc.
Joseph F. Gundersen, Indiana Department of Transportation

Cold milling operations have been utilized for over two decades in Indiana but little attention was given to the “quality” of the operations. Several alternatives for evaluating surface macrotexture were considered as a quality measure. ASTM E 965-96 was selected as the best existing procedure on which to base evaluation of milled surfaces. The Indiana DOT developed test method ITM 812-03T to make the ASTM procedures workable for milled surfaces. The initial quality of Hot Mix Asphalt (HMA) construction directly affects the return on investment with the long-term performance and the service life of a transportation facility. The initial quality of construction is directly dependent upon the quality of the aggregates and binders and the production and laydown operations. Construction factors affect the initial quality including surface preparation procedures that is the removal of distressed materials (cold milling) to develop a stable working platform on which Hot Mix Asphalt materials can be placed. The Indiana Hot Mix Asphalt contractors were experiencing numerous problems meeting the volumetric and density quality requirements on highway construction projects. A significant number of HMA mixtures were either being accepted with partial payment or replaced prior to being accepted. Investigation of the problem included observing the contractor’s Certified HMA Plant Production operations, mixture components (i.e., aggregates, binders, etc), mixture transportation, laydown and compaction, and also mixture sampling procedures. It was discovered that more problems existed when cold milling of the existing surface was included in the project. A solution to the noted issues resulted in the development of improved milling design and construction requirements, which includes quality measurements techniques for the milling operations.
